AS9100 is the quality management system standard for the aerospace industry. It requires strict adherence to quality and reliability standards in aerospace, including corrective actions to drive consistency for mission-critical products.
“This is an important milestone for Celestica, as we can now extend our aerospace manufacturing and engineering services offering to our customers for the expanding market in China,” said Michael J. McGuire, Vice President, Aerospace and Defense, Celestica. “This certification is also a reflection of Celestica’s ongoing commitment to provide innovative and cost competitive services on a global basis for our aerospace customers.”
The Suzhou, China facility is Celestica’s fifth AS9100-certified Center of Excellence for aerospace manufacturing, joining Toronto, Canada; Austin, Texas; Valencia, Spain; and Kulim, Malaysia.
In addition to AS9100 certification, Celestica is also fully qualified to meet other rigorous standards of the aerospace and defense industry, such as ITAR (USA), CGP (Canada), ISO 9001:2000, AS9100, AS9110, J-STD-001/ IPC 610C level 3, ANSI/ESD S20:20, J-STD-001 / IPC 610D level 3, and Nadcap.
